Reserves Day: Defence Secretary holds reception for reservists at Number 10

Watch: Reservists visit Downing Street.

One hundred and fifty reservists and veterans from the Civil Service were welcomed to 10 Downing Street by Defence Secretary Ben Wallace on Wednesday.

They attended a reception marking Reserves Day which celebrates the role of reservists in the UK Armed Forces and sees them wear their military uniform in their civilian life for a day.

The tri-service reservists and veterans who attended the reception are part of the new Civil Service Armed Forces Network which has been set up to support, mentor and champion the skills of veterans, reservists and their families who work across the Civil Service.
